Common Lennox HVAC Problems We Solve in Vista

  • Compressor overwork and premature failure. Vista’s inland summers push well past 90°F, and during Santa Ana events we see triple digits with humidity in the single digits. Lennox XC14 and XC16 units sized for coastal assumptions run flat out, overheat, and cook the compressor. We see this most in the 92083 ranch homes near downtown where original ductwork leaks like a sieve and the compressor never cycles off.
  • Refrigerant leaks at flare fittings and evaporator coils. The thermal cycling here is brutal — 100°F afternoons, then rapid cooldown when the marine layer occasionally pushes far enough inland. That expansion and contraction fatigues copper. In the older 92084 tract homes with attic-mounted air handlers, we find pinhole leaks in the evaporator that coastal techs misdiagnose as “low on charge” and keep topping off.
  • Variable-capacity board failures in Lennox SLP98V and EL296V furnaces. These modulating systems are sophisticated, but the control boards hate voltage sags. SDG&E’s inland grid gets stressed hard during heat events, and we’ve replaced more of these boards in Vista than in any comparable coastal market. Daniel keeps compatible boards on the truck because it’s a known pattern here.
  • Dirty condensers choked with dust and Santa Ana debris. Those hot easterly winds carry fine particulate from the backcountry. Lennox outdoor coils packed with dust can’t reject heat. The XC20 and XP25 heat pumps are especially sensitive — their variable-speed compressors ramp up to compensate, drawing more power and wearing faster. We clean deeper than a garden-hose rinse.
  • Zoning failures in multi-story homes on Vista’s hillsides. The 92081 corridor near SR-78 has newer construction with Lennox iComfort zoning, but the duct runs are long and the static pressure is wrong from day one. Dampers stick, zone boards throw errors, and homeowners end up heating the upstairs while the downstairs freezes. Daniel maps the actual airflow and fixes the root cause, not just the symptom.

Lennox Service in Vista: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Vista sits roughly 8–10 miles inland, just past where the Pacific marine layer reliably stalls, so summer afternoons regularly hit the low-to-mid 90s while neighboring Carlsbad and Oceanside stay 15–20°F cooler — yet many homeowners and even out-of-area contractors treat it as a “coastal” San Diego climate and undersize equipment or skip cooling altogether. HVAC contractors in Vista must correct this mismatch constantly, especially for residents relocating from the coast who are blindsided by their first inland summer.

For Lennox owners, this means your system’s rated capacity and your home’s actual load are probably misaligned if the original installer didn’t run a proper Manual J. The older single-pane stucco homes clustered near downtown Vista in 92083 radiate so much absorbed heat overnight that systems sized to modest design-day assumptions cannot recover. We’ve walked into kitchens at 10 PM that still read 82°F inside because the Lennox unit was spec’d for coastal Oceanside conditions and never had a chance. During Santa Ana events, that problem goes from annoying to unlivable — dry, superheated air from the east pushes temperatures above 100°F and drops relative humidity below 10%, putting maximum simultaneous strain on cooling, filtration, and humidity control. Your Lennox needs to be genuinely rated for high-ambient-temperature operation, not coastal-light-duty, and the duct system needs to be sealed and insulated like it’s Phoenix, not Pacific Beach. Lennox Models & Products We Service in Vista

We work on the full Lennox residential and light commercial lineup: Merit series (ML180, ML193, ML195 furnaces; 13ACX and 14ACX air conditioners), Elite series (EL180, EL195, EL296V furnaces; XC14, XC16, XC20 air conditioners; XP14, XP16, XP20 heat pumps), and Dave Lennox Signature Collection (SLP98V furnace, XC25 air conditioner, XP25 heat pump). We also service Lennox iComfort thermostats and zoning controls, plus packaged units like the LRP14 and LRP16.

Lennox Service Pricing in Vista

Here’s what independent Lennox service costs through Northstar Heating & Air:

Service Price Range
Lennox AC Repair $175–$765
Lennox Furnace Repair $175–$825
Lennox AC Installation $4,130–$8,850
Lennox Tune-Up / Maintenance $95–$235

What drives the number? Compressor replacement sits at the top of that AC repair range; a failed capacitor or contactor sits at the bottom. Furnace repairs climb when we’re replacing a modulating gas valve or control board in an SLP98V. Installation pricing depends on whether we’re matching a new Lennox to existing ductwork or rebuilding from the plenum out — something we evaluate honestly, not with a flat rate that hides surprises.
